How to Choose a Casino Online

Online casino games allow players to play a wide variety of popular casino games over the Internet. These games can be played either via a computer browser or, in more advanced cases, through dedicated casino apps for mobile devices such as smartphones and tablets. These apps typically offer a seamless experience that mirrors the desktop version, including secure transactions and full account management. The best casino online sites also have a robust customer support service, offering live chat and phone support for any issues that might arise.

The main advantage of playing casino games online is the ability to access a wider range of games than at a bricks and mortar establishment. Additionally, a regulated casino online is required to adhere to strict security protocols that help protect your personal information and financial data. This helps to ensure that the games you play are fair and that your transactions are safe. In addition, many reputable casinos provide generous bonuses to new players. These incentives can help to offset the initial cost of opening an account.

Before you start playing at an online casino, it’s important to research the site to ensure that it is legitimate and complies with your state’s gaming regulations. It’s also a good idea to look for any reviews or comments about the casino that you can find on the web. Many of these reviews are written by other players and can give you a great idea about whether or not the casino is right for you.

When choosing an online casino, you should make sure that the website offers your preferred game. There are hundreds of websites that offer gambling services, and each one has its own unique selection of games. Some may even offer multiple versions of a single game, such as roulette. It’s also a good idea check the minimum and maximum bet amounts for each game, as well as any rules or strategies that you need to follow.

You should also make sure that the casino you choose is licensed and has a reputation for honesty. This is especially important if you plan to wager real money. Most online casinos will verify your identity before allowing you to deposit and withdraw funds. This process usually involves sending copies of your government-issued ID or other documents, such as utility bills. If you’re not comfortable providing this information, you should consider choosing a different casino.
